24 November 2010 What is the limit of amount for an individual can to receive tax free gifts from non-blood relatives/friends? If an individual gets a 3Lac gift from his parents (tax free as blood relation)and as well taxable gift from his friend within the limit discussed above, in the same year, will this additional gift amount even under tax limit be taxable? 24 November 2010 RS. 50000/ IN A YEAR FROM ALL NON RELATIVE GIFT IS EXEMPTED.

ANY GIFT FROM RELATIVE WILL NOT BE TAXABLE.
NON RELATIVE GIFT WILL BE TAXABLE IN EXCESS OF RS. 50000.
